Though this small town in Wyoming may easily be looked over as any other forgettable town that isn't on the east or west coast, it is a truly a marvelous place. Nestled near the foothills of the Wind River Range, and Sinks Canyon, residents have as their backyard the greatest limestone rock climbing in the world, hikes, and incredible geological features. The community is strong, hearty, and sticks together. Though you can see the obvious tensions between the generations as our culture becomes more and more politically polarized, but for the most part, Lander is still relatively libertarian/conservative. The health care can most certainly be better, just ask any resident. The education is great here, we have a fantastic liberal arts school with teachers from all around the world, NOLS, a Montessori school, and a fantastic public school. Housing is difficult to come by, and it is a big issue for Lander, since many people want to move to Lander, but cannot find a place to stay.
Lander, WY is noisy. First responder agencies in town run sirens on almost every call. Multiple tornado sirens around town are used to notify firefighters of fire callouts and are wake-the-dead loud. This is almost daily. If only a few firefighters respond to the station, it is set off again. They are loud because they are 'tornado' sirens not pagers. There are firefighter response apps that the city or fire district could invest in that are useful, such as 'I am responding.' And, there is a rodeo every Saturday night in the summer with music blasted until midnight. Same thing with fourth of July, the fireworks show goes until midnight and it sounds like a war zone. This is a small rural town, not a metropolitan area. The town needs to do a noise study/survey, with community input, and manage this better. Lander is not a peaceful place.
